Assumptions: standard 38″ x 75″ twin size, factory-direct or retail stores, residential delivery, no bulky foundations beyond a basic bed frame, and mid-range materials in common markets.

Typical Twin Mattress Price You Can Expect

The total price for a standard twin mattress generally falls in a broad range from around $150 on the low end to about $900 on the high end. A typical midrange twin mattress often lands near $350 to $550. The main drivers are foam density, spring count or coil type, cover materials, and whether a foundation or frame is included in the package. Prices vary by brand, retailer, and local promotions.

Item Low Average High Notes
Mattress price $150 $350 $900 Common sizes; promotions affect the low end
Delivery and setup $0 $50 $150 Depends on distance and service level
Foundation or frame $0 $100 $350 Box springs, platform bases, or metal frames
Warranty/coverage $0 $25 $100 Often included; extended plans vary

Variables That Change Twin Mattress Pricing

Pricing swings with foam density and support system; region and retailer also affect totals. Foam density (ILD) and coil count are two numeric levers buyers should watch, along with whether a foundation is included. Regional labor costs can shift the final quote by 10–25%.

  • Material type: memory foam versus innerspring or hybrid
  • Foam ILD (compression rating) and cover fabric
  • Foundation inclusion: box spring, slatted base, or platform
  • Delivery distance and access constraints
  • Warranty length and coverage tier
  • Promotions, bundles, and regional inventory

Assumptions: standard twin with no custom upholstery; metro-area delivery typical.

Estimate Scenarios: Budget, Midrange, Premium Twin Mattresses

Concrete example ranges help buyers compare offers. A hypothetical budget scenario might land at $180–$320 total, excluding extended warranties. A midrange package could be $350–$550, while a premium setup might run $700–$900 with advanced foams and enhanced fabrics. Scenarios reflect typical regional variations and current promotions.

Scenario Mattress Foundation Delivery Total Notes
Budget $180 $0 $0 $180–$230 Solid basic foam
Midrange $320 $100 $60 $480–$550 Average density foam
Premium $550 $180 $70 $780–$900 Hybrid or high-density foam
